Overview

ST-02 is a novel mucoadhesive suspension of gemcitabine, specifically formulated for pyelocaliceal instillation. It is being investigated for the local treatment of low-grade Upper Tract Urothelial Carcinoma (UTUC). This formulation allows for direct delivery of the chemotherapeutic agent, gemcitabine, to the upper urinary tract, enabling a localized and extended therapeutic effect.
